P2373 Moderate Generic / SAE

P2373: Fuel Volume Regulator B Control Circuit High

What this code means

The B regulator's control circuit reads high — shorted to a supply, or open in a circuit that rests high. The mirror of P2372, with one wrinkle worth knowing: a line stuck in the driven state holds the valve at whatever the stuck command demands, which can mean rail pressure pinned high or starved depending on the valve's sense. The companion rail-pressure codes name the direction; the wiring names the cause.
